Just how overdue are the Firebird results?
Just going through the published news releases by ALX Resources ... June 14, 2021 Firebird drilling commenced
Aug 3, 2021 Hits sulphide minereralization at Firebird
- ALX Resources Corp. has completed a diamond drilling program at its Firebird nickel project located near the town of Stony Rapids in Northern Saskatchewan
- The helicopter-assisted drilling program began in the third week of June, 2021, on the first of four high-priority targets. Ground geophysical surveys were carried out on three targets to improve the definition of the conductive anomalies detected in a 2020 airborne survey. A total of 739.5 metres was completed in four diamond drill holes.
- When logging the drill core, a portable X-ray fluorescence device was used to confirm the presence of nickel and copper; however, absolute geochemical values cannot be reliably estimated and consequently are not reported at this time. Drill core is being shipped for analysis to ALS Global's geochemistry analytical lab in North Vancouver, B.C., Canada. Results are expected later in August, 2021, and will be released by the company after their receipt, compilation and interpretation.
- All samples are shipped by ground to ALS Global's geochemistry analytical lab in North Vancouver, B.C., Canada, for multielement analysis. ALS is an ISO-IEC 17025:2017 and ISO 9001:2015 accredited analytical laboratory that is independent of ALX and its qualified person.
No other headline news releases mentioning Firebird.
It seems forever however it would appear that the delay has only been 2 months however hopefully an announcement should be imminent ...
